A General Synthesis of Crystal Phase Controllable Aerogels for Efficient Hydrogen Evolution

Abstract

Abstract Amorphous/crystalline (a/c) hetero‐phase structures are considered as a class of efficient electrocatalysts for hydrogen evolution reaction (HER), but it remains a substantial challenge to obtain the specific phase by phase‐selective synthesis. In this work, a general route for the preparation of various heterogeneous aerogels (RuB, PtB, PdB, and RhB) consisting of amorphous and crystalline phases is presented through a controlled NaBH 4 reduction method. The prepared a/c‐RuB aerogel exhibits better HER performance due to their desirable compositional and structural advantages such as more exposed active sites, optimized electronic structure, and interfacial synergistic effects. It requires only a low overpotential of 39 mV to reach a density of 10 mA cm −2 and also exhibits excellent stability. This work provides a new phase‐selective synthesis strategy for the design and development of advanced hetero‐phase electrocatalysts.
